Abstract

本发明公开了一种太阳能模块支架,用以固定一太阳能面板,所述太阳能模块支架包含配置于太阳能面板的两个对边的两个第一紧固件、配置在太阳能面板的另两个对边的两个第二紧固件,以及多个螺丝。螺丝用以锁固第一紧固件与第二紧固件。每个第一紧固件及每个第二紧固件各包含用于支撑太阳能面板的支撑部、底部、用于连接该支撑部及底部的连接部,以及设置在支撑部与底部之间的肋部。

Figure 201010622261

The present invention discloses a solar module support for fixing a solar panel, wherein the solar module support comprises two first fasteners arranged at two opposite sides of the solar panel, two second fasteners arranged at the other two opposite sides of the solar panel, and a plurality of screws. The screws are used to lock the first fasteners and the second fasteners. Each first fastener and each second fastener comprises a support portion for supporting the solar panel, a bottom portion, a connection portion for connecting the support portion and the bottom portion, and a rib portion arranged between the support portion and the bottom portion.

Embodiment
Below will clearly demonstrate spirit of the present invention with accompanying drawing and detailed description, those of ordinary skill is after understanding preferred embodiment of the present invention in any affiliated technical field, when can be by the technology of teachings of the present invention, change and modification, it does not break away from spirit of the present invention and scope.
Referring to Fig. 1.Fig. 1 is the schematic diagram of an embodiment that utilizes the solar energy module of support of the present invention.Solar energy module 100 comprises solar panel 110 and support 120, and support 120 is used for fixing solar panel 110.Solar panel 110 is a rectangular slab.Support 120 comprises around first securing member 130 of solar panel 110 and second securing member, 140, the first securing members 130 and second securing member 140 coupled to each other so that solar panel 110 is fixing within it.Support 120 has two first securing members 130, is arranged on two opposite side places of solar panel 110.Support 120 has two second securing members 140, is arranged on two opposite side places in addition of solar panel 110.Solar energy module 100 also comprises a plurality of screws 150, in order to first securing member, 130 screw fixed to the second securing members 140.
Referring to Fig. 2.Fig. 2 is the cross-sectional view of first securing member of Fig. 1 medium-height trestle.First securing member 130 has one first support portion 131, one first bottom 138 and one first connecting portion 136.First connecting portion 136 is used to connect first support portion 131 and first bottom 138.First support portion 131 has one first groove 133.Solar panel (not illustrating among the figure) is assemblied in first groove 133.There are one first flange 132 and one second flange 134 in first support portion 131.Second flange 134 is used for solar panel is supported thereon, and first flange 132 is used to locate solar panel.First groove 133 is formed between first flange 132 and second flange 134.Solar panel is clipped between first flange 132 and second flange 134.
First securing member 130 has one first flank 135.First flank 135 is arranged between second flange 134 and first bottom 138.In the present embodiment, the opposite side of first flank 135 connects second flange 134 and first bottom 138 respectively.Cavity 139 is formed between first flank 135 and first connecting portion 136 and reaches between second flange 134 and first bottom 138.First flank 135 is supporting solar panels and strengthen the bending strength of first securing member 130 further.
Solar energy module support 120 can also comprise a packing ring 160, is arranged between the solar panel and first support portion 131, in order to the conduct buffering.Packing ring 160 can be made by elastomeric material, and for example, elastomeric material or polymeric material damage because of directly contacting first securing member 130 to avoid solar panel.Second flange 134 has a trip 137, to catch on packing ring 160.First securing member 130 can be made by metallic plate.First securing member 130 can be made of aluminum.
Referring to Fig. 3.Fig. 3 is the cross-sectional view of second securing member of Fig. 1 medium-height trestle.Second securing member 140 comprises second support portion 142, second bottom 144 and second connecting portion 146.Second connecting portion 146 connects second support portion 142 and second bottom 144.There is second groove 143 second support portion 142, and solar panel (not illustrating among the figure) is assemblied in second groove 143.Second securing member 140 has second flank 148, and it is arranged between second support portion 142 and second bottom 144.The opposite side of second flank 148 connects second support portion 142 and second bottom 144 respectively.Cavity 147 is formed between second flank 148 and second connecting portion 146.Second flank 148 is supporting solar panels and strengthen the bending strength of second securing member 140 further.
Second securing member 140 also comprises a plurality of locking parts 145.Locking part 145 is arranged on second support portion 142 and second bottom 144.The shape of cross section of locking part 145 can be C shape.Locking part 145 is configured between second flank 148 and second connecting portion 146.Second securing member 140 can be made by metallic plate.The material of second securing member 140 can be aluminium.
Simultaneously referring to Fig. 4 and Fig. 5.Fig. 4 is the three-dimensional view of first securing member of the present invention.Fig. 5 is the three-dimensional view of second securing member of the present invention.Second securing member 140 has a plurality of locking parts 145, and it is arranged between second support portion 142 and second bottom 144.Second flank, 148 connection second support portions 142 and second bottom 144 are to strengthen the bending strength of second securing member 140.
First securing member 130 has a plurality of screw holes 170, and its locking part 145 corresponding to second securing member 140 is provided with.Screw 150 among Fig. 1 locks locking part 145 on screw hole 170, and then first securing member 130 is secured to second securing member 140.
First securing member among the present invention and the flank of second securing member can strengthen the bending strength of solar energy module support effectively, so that the thickness of the metallic plate of first securing member and second securing member can reduce.First securing member and second securing member are fixed by screw, and first securing member and second securing member can firmly and preferably be fixed whereby.The flank of each first securing member and each second securing member, support portion, bottom, and connecting portion can be in one piece and make.First securing member and second securing member are made of metal, with the ground connection interface as solar panel.
